Ministry of Labor’s administrative guidelines to stop gender discrimination in recruitment and employment processes

As the season comes closer where many enterprises employ most of their new workforce, the Ministry of Labor has decided to provide guidance to state-owned enterprises and government subsidiaries (211), financial institutions (114), major corporations and other establishments to recruit and employ new workers without gender discrimination.

The Ministry will provide guidelines for gender discrimination assessment in recruitment and employment advertisements for 26 enterprises including media enterprises, job information newspapers, free newspaper publishers, and has requested for their cooperation in assuring that there will be no gender discriminatory contents in employment advertisements.

Also, 46 regional labor offices have decided to provide administrative guidelines to major local enterprises to stop gender discrimination in the recruitment and employment process. Local officials will also provide guidelines to local newspapers, local private broadcasting stations, and wired broadcasting stations to prevent gender discriminatory contents from appearing in employment advertisements.

Last year, the Ministry of Labor assessed the actual conditions of equality of employment achievement, and inspected reported cases in various industries such as food, lodging, and telecommunications. The Ministry found 28 cases of discrimination in recruitment and employment processes, and took legal action against 3 cases, and ordered readjustments or gave warning to the other cases.
